<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Brooke is the managing senior associate of Wiley’s Health Care Practice. She advises clients on complex service contracting, with a deep expertise in pharmacy benefit management (PBM) agreements for commercial and government-sponsored health care programs, including Medicare, Medicaid, and the Federal Employees Health Benefits Program (FEHBP). Her practice focuses on health care contracting and negotiation strategy, regulatory compliance, and dispute resolution.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Brooke also advises non-health care clients on a broad range of health care regulatory, privacy, transactional, and litigation matters. Prior to joining Wiley, Brooke represented major manufacturing clients in complex litigation and advised for-profit and exempt organizations on a wide variety of corporate matters, including the drafting and negotiation of various commercial agreements and advising on corporate compliance and governance issues.</span></p>
<p> </p>
<h4>What advice would you offer to new attorneys interested in your field?</h4>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Health care law is constantly evolving, so one of the most valuable habits you can develop is intellectual curiosity. Build a strong foundation in statutory and regulatory analysis but also take the time to understand how your clients’ businesses operate. The best advice is often practical as well as legally sound. Develop excellent writing and negotiation skills, as many matters are resolved through thoughtful drafting, careful communication, and creative problem-solving. Don’t be afraid to tackle complex regulations or unfamiliar subject matter; those challenges are often where you’ll grow the most. Seek mentors who will invest in your development. Ask questions and be willing to learn from colleagues across different practice areas. Finally, remember that credibility is earned over time. Be thorough, responsive, and dependable, and your clients and colleagues will come to trust your judgment on increasingly sophisticated matters.</span></p>

<div class="et_pb_text_7 et_pb_text et_pb_bg_layout_light et_pb_module et_block_module"><div class="et_pb_text_inner"><h4>Description of field of expertise</h4>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Structured finance and securitization is a specialized area of legal practice focused on the creation, structuring, and issuance of financial instruments backed by pools of underlying assets. The field involves the transformation of illiquid assets into tradeable securities through legally engineered structures designed to isolate credit risk, achieve bankruptcy remoteness, and allocate cash flows among various classes of investors. It sits at the intersection of capital markets, banking, and regulatory law, requiring practitioners to navigate complex documentation frameworks, rating agency methodologies, and evolving regulatory requirements.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;"><br /></span><span style="font-weight: 400;">As an associate in structured finance I am developing a foundational expertise in the legal and financial mechanics underlying asset-backed transactions. I possess a working knowledge of structuring, documentation, and execution of securitization transactions across a variety of asset classes, including credit card receivables, esoteric assets, and other consumer and commercial asset pools.</span></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">My role entails reviewing and drafting both ancillary and core transaction documents, including pooling and servicing agreements, indentures, credit enhancement arrangements, and offering memoranda. I support senior team members in conducting due diligence on originators and servicers, analyzing waterfall payment structures, and evaluating the legal isolation of assets through true sale opinions and bankruptcy-remoteness analysis. I maintain a developing understanding of credit enhancement mechanisms, including subordination, overcollateralization, excess spread, and reserve accounts, and apply that knowledge to ensure structural integrity and investor protection within each deal.</span></p>

<h4>What advice would you offer to new attorneys interested in your field?</h4>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">For new attorneys interested in this area, my advice is to focus on understanding deal mechanics alongside the law, get hands-on with documents as early as possible, and pay attention to how all the moving parts of a transaction fit together. Staying current on regulatory developments and being patient with the steep learning curve will go a long way in establishing yourself in this practice.</span></p>

<h4>What advice would you offer to new attorneys interested in your field?</h4>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Clear, precise legal writing is central to appellate practice, and improving requires more than accumulating drafts. Two habits will sharpen both your writing and your judgment. First, study the substantive edits to your own work—whether a brief, letter, motion, or section of a larger document. Compare your draft with the final version and look beyond wording. Ask questions: why one argument was narrowed, why another moved forward, why a seemingly minor fact became central, why an entire argument or issue was removed. For court filings, follow the thread: read the court's opinion and examine which arguments it engaged with, what it found persuasive, and what it passed over. Second, read exceptional briefs and opinions with the same eye—notice which arguments lead, how the standard of review shapes the framing, and how facts and doctrine work together. These habits will make you both a better writer and sharper advocate.</span></p>

<h4>What advice would you offer to new attorneys interested in your field?</h4>
<p><b>Stay Engaged.</b><span style="font-weight: 400;"> If you’re interested in antitrust, stay engaged. Antitrust lawyers are always following high-profile cases, enforcement actions, and regulatory developments. An easy way to stay engaged with the field is to subscribe to leading antitrust publications, such as </span><i><span style="font-weight: 400;">Global Competition Review</span></i><span style="font-weight: 400;">, </span><i><span style="font-weight: 400;">Concurrences</span></i><span style="font-weight: 400;">, and </span><i><span style="font-weight: 400;">ABA Antitrust Magazine</span></i><span style="font-weight: 400;">; follow FTC and DOJ press releases, speeches, and policy statements; and listen to podcasts, such as </span><i><span style="font-weight: 400;">Our Curious Amalgam</span></i><span style="font-weight: 400;">. As you continue to engage, you might discover a particular interest in a cross-industry focus like algorithmic pricing, or advising on strategic transactions or antitrust litigation. </span></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><b>Make Lasting Connections</b><span style="font-weight: 400;">. The value of attending conferences cannot be overstated. Conferences, like the ABA Antitrust Spring Meeting and Bill Kovacic Antitrust Salon, are a great opportunity to deepen your professional network.</span></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><b>Get Published!</b><span style="font-weight: 400;"> Seek opportunities to contribute to thought leadership through articles, client alerts, or bar association publications to refine your ideas and highlight your expertise.</span></p>

<h4>What advice would you offer to new attorneys interested in your field?</h4>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">One thing I always tell new attorneys is that careers in law rarely follow a straight line—and that’s okay. You don’t have to follow a defined path to get where you want to go. In law school, I really liked my juvenile defense clinic, but I never imagined I would actually end up in criminal defense, and definitely not for five years. The recession pushed me into public service, and it turned out to be one of the most formative parts of my career. As a public defender, I learned how to build a defense from the ground up—conducting investigations, interviewing witnesses, reviewing evidence closely, trying cases, and learning how to really talk to people. When I decided I wanted to try something new, I leaned on those skills to transition into employment law and eventually into Big Law. The foundation was already there; I just needed to build subject-matter expertise. I studied relentlessly, took every continuing education opportunity I could, and read every practice guide I could get my hands on. Trust that your experiences will carry forward, even when the path shifts.</span></p>
